「图形空格Java」图形空格填数
本篇文章给大家谈谈图形空格Java,以及图形空格填数对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
- 1、java编程题,运用do-while产生如下图形,(注意空格)求大神帮助、
- 2、Java,编写菱形,1.这段代码是怎么做到控制星号和空格的位置的?2.上半部分大for循环一次后是什么样的?
- 3、Java 中的空格符、换行符等怎么表示
- 4、打印以下图案(每行打5个星号,每个星号之间空两格空格)请在java中实现
java编程题,运用do-while产生如下图形,(注意空格)求大神帮助、
public static void main(String [] args) {
int s = 0;
int i = 1, n = 22;
do {
int j = i;
if (n = 10) {
if (i 10) {
s = 0;
} else {
if (i != 10)
s = n - 10 + 1;
else
s = n - 10;
}
}
for (int l = 0; l (n - i) * 2 + s; l++) {
System.out.print(" ");
}
if (i 10 i != n) {
for (int l = 0; l n - i - 1; l++) {
System.out.print(" ");
}
System.out.print(" ");
}
if (j != 1) {
for (; j 1; j--) {
System.out.print(j + " ");
}
}
j = 1;
for (; j = i; j++) {
System.out.print(j + " ");
}
System.out.println();
i++;
} while (i = n);
}
Java,编写菱形,1.这段代码是怎么做到控制星号和空格的位置的?2.上半部分大for循环一次后是什么样的?
第一: 上半部分的for循环最后一次结束后,是输出了上半部分的三角。 这个代码其实就是把菱形拆分成了两个三角形,上面的三角形和下面的三角形, 分别用两个for来实现,
第二:实现这种输出图形的思路: 你要把菱形看成是一个二维数组,其实就是m*n行的二维数组,只不过就是二维数组的某些元素是空格, 而某些元素是星号*。 这样就组成了菱形。
Java 中的空格符、换行符等怎么表示
特殊字符的表示方法::
1、\t 空格 ('\u0009')
2、\n 换行 ('\u000A')
3、\\ 反斜杠
4、\r 回车 ('\u000D')
5、\d 数字等价于[0-9]
6、\D 非数字等价于[^0-9]
7、\s 空白符号 [\t\n\x0B\f\r]
8、\S 非空白符号 [^\t\n\x0B\f\r]
9、\w 单独字符 [a-zA-Z_0-9]
10、\W 非单独字符 [^a-zA-Z_0-9]
11、\f 换页符
12、\e Escape
扩展资料:
Java
1、Java是一门面向对象编程语言,不仅吸收了C++语言的各种优点,还摒弃了C++里难以理解的多继承、指针等概念,因此Java语言具有功能强大和简单易用两个特征。Java语言作为静态面向对象编程语言的代表,极好地实现了面向对象理论,允许程序员以优雅的思维方式进行复杂的编程。
2、Java具有简单性、面向对象、分布式、健壮性、安全性、平台独立与可移植性、多线程、动态性等特点。Java可以编写桌面应用程序、Web应用程序、分布式系统和嵌入式系统应用程序等。
参考资料来源:百度百科-Java
打印以下图案(每行打5个星号,每个星号之间空两格空格)请在java中实现
for(int i=1;i=5;i++){ for(int j=1;j=i;j++){ System.out.print(" "); } for(int j=1;j=5;j++){ System.out.print("* "); } System.out.println(""); }
图形空格Java的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于图形空格填数、图形空格Java的信息别忘了在本站进行查找喔。
发布于:2022-12-26,除非注明,否则均为
原创文章,转载请注明出处。